Why Siding and Exterior Sales in New York Pay So Well
New York's aging housing stock is a closer's best friend. Millions of homes across Brooklyn, Queens, Staten Island, Long Island, and Westchester County were built decades ago, and their exteriors show it. Homeowners in these markets are highly motivated buyers. When a siding system is failing, curb appeal is suffering, or energy bills are climbing because of inadequate exterior insulation, the urgency is real and the budgets follow. Average project values in the New York metro frequently run between $15,000 and $45,000, which means commission checks are substantial even on a modest closing rate.
Unlike lower-ticket verticals, siding and exterior replacement is a true one-call close business. You run one appointment, present one solution, and handle objections until you have a decision. There is no drawn-out pipeline, no waiting on a procurement department, and no chasing a lead for weeks. That structure rewards skilled closers immediately and directly through commission. Many companies offer a base plus commission structure, while others offer straight commission with higher upside. Either way, no degree required means your earning potential is determined by your performance, not your resume.
What the Day-to-Day Actually Looks Like
Most siding sales roles in New York are appointment-set, meaning the company generates and qualifies leads through canvassing, digital marketing, or a dedicated call center. You show up at the homeowner's door prepared to deliver a full in-home presentation, measure the exterior, build value around the product, and close the deal before you leave. The best companies in this market provide strong appointment volume, financing options to handle price objections, and ongoing training to sharpen your demo and objection handling skills.
- Appointment volume: Expect four to eight pre-set appointments per week, depending on season and company size.
- Product knowledge: You will need to speak confidently about fiber cement, vinyl, insulated siding systems, and trim options relevant to New York's climate and architecture.
- Financing conversations: Most New York homeowners finance large exterior projects, so comfort with monthly payment presentations is critical.
- Objection handling: Common objections include "I want to get more quotes," "I need to talk to my spouse," and "I wasn't expecting it to cost that much." Your ability to resolve these in the moment is what separates six-figure earners from average performers.
How to Land a High-Ticket Siding Sales Job in New York
The process is straightforward if you approach it with the same confidence you would bring to a homeowner appointment. Companies hiring for these roles prioritize coachability, communication skills, and a track record of closing, whether that track record comes from roofing, solar, HVAC, windows, remodeling, or even an entirely different sales background.
- Build a profile on Salesman Connect that highlights any previous commission-based or high-ticket sales experience, even outside home improvement.
- Be specific about your closing metrics. List your average deal size, closing percentage, and OTE from previous roles. Numbers get callbacks.
- Apply to multiple siding and exterior companies operating in the New York metro so you can compare commission structures, appointment volume, and training quality before you commit.
- Prepare a strong 30-second pitch for your interview. Hiring managers in this vertical run their interviews like a sales call. Demonstrate that you can communicate value quickly and handle pushback.
- Ask the right questions about lead flow. The difference between a $70,000 year and a $190,000 year is often appointment quality. Understand how leads are generated and what quota expectations look like before you accept an offer.
